If A(2,4) is reflected over the x-axis, what are it’s new coordinates ?
Sav [38]

Answer:

(2,-4)

Step-by-step explanation

When you reflect a point across the x-axis, the x-coordinate remains the same, but the y-coordinate is transformed into its opposite (its sign is changed). If you forget the rules for reflections when graphing, simply fold your paper along the x-axis (the line of reflection) to see where the new figure will be located.

Find the polar equation of the conic with the focus at the pole, directrix x = -5, and eccentricity 2.
prohojiy [21]

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that,

Directrix, d= -5, and eccentricity, e = 2.

The polar equation of the conic is given by :

r=\dfrac{ed}{1-e\cos\theta}

Put all the values,

r=\dfrac{-5\times 2}{1-2\cos\theta}\\\\=\dfrac{-10}{1-2\cos\theta}

As e>1, it is a hyperbola. Hence, this is the required solution.
